On 20/01/2019 13:30, Mungo Carstairs (Staff) wrote:
>
> I can't see commit history on issues today (from home), instead I'm seeing
>
>   * Request to https://source.jalview.org/crucible/ failed: Error in
>     remote call to 'source' (https://source.jalview.org/crucible)
>     [AbstractRestCommand{path='rest-service/search-v1/reviews',
>     params={maxReturn=50, term=JAL-3187}, methodType=GET}] :
>     javax.net.ssl.SSLHandshakeException:
>     sun.security.validator.ValidatorException: PKIX path building
>     failed:
>     sun.security.provider.certpath.SunCertPathBuilderException: unable
>     to find valid certification path to requested target
>
> But I can browse to https://source.jalview.org/crucible
> <https://source.jalview.org/crucible> without any warnings.
>
> Any ideas what the problem is?
>
Not yet. The *.jalview.org SSL cert was updated, and it's possible the
old cert has been cached by Jira (I was hoping it would sort itself out,
but clearly not). I'll restart the servers and refresh their
interconnect config again to see if it flushes the problem.
